

From 12 to 19 October 2014 in the capital of Polish people's Republic took place ХХI national philatelic exhibition «Warsaw - 2014».
Significantly, the forum was held in the halls of Olympic centre under the name of John Paul II, because this year marks the 95th anniversary of the formation of Polish Olympic Committee, the 90th anniversary of the first performance of Polish athletes under its own flag of an independent state, the 70th anniversary of the Warsaw Uprising, which was attended by several hundred athletes, including eight Olympic champions.
In 1919 in Warsaw hosted the first general-Polish philatelic exhibition, and now 95 years later - XXI.
Presented exhibits introduce visitors with a variety of pages of the history and modernity, primarily with postal history and Polish stamp, the history of Polish lands, history of Poland.
On the eve of the opening of exhibition, Polish volleyball fans pleased with the victory at the World Cup, and the Polish Post on this occasion in a few days produced philatelic sheet with portraits of champions. On the presentation, which took place on 18 October, it was possible not only to buy stamps, make a cancellation, but also to communicate with the head coach of champions Stephane Antiga and, if lucky, get an autograph.

Among the official guests of the exhibition, invited by the Polish Union of Philatelists, was a delegation from the city, which included the chairman of the society I. Panonko and activist V. Pruhnitskiy. Arrival of Lviv people became a logical continuation of the development of friendly relations and deepen cooperation of twinned societies of cities Lublin and Lviv. The Chairman of the Lublin branch of the Polish Union of philatelists Ryszard Kuśmierski took care of the delegation of Lviv and Brest.
